Lamb Chops with Brown Sauce
Cut a few lamb chops about one-fourth of an inch thick, trim nicely, dip them in beaten egg, then roll them in a seasoning of finely minced parsley, a little salt and pepper, lemon peel, and a small quantity of grated nutmeg. Heat a large lump of butter in a deep fryingpan over the fire, then put in the chops, and fry until well browned. Put one tablespoonful of flour and a small lump of butter into a stewpan, stir over the fire, then pour in one-half pint of clear veal gravy, and stir until boiling; drain the chops, put them on a hot dish, stir in one wineglassful of red wine with the sauce, strain it over the chops, and serve.
